NTC Memorandum: Guidelines On Prepaid Load

The National Telecommunications Commission (NTC) had issued the Memorandum Circular dated July 3, 2009 with the subject titled as “Guidelines On Prepaid Load” to TelCos (telecommunication Companies) such as Smart Communications, Globe Telecoms, Sun etc. This is in response to complaint of Senate President Enrile about the mysterious disappearance of his prepaid load.

Anyway, going back to the memorandum, the new expiration or validity period are as follows:

Prepaid Load Purchased
Expiration/Validity Period
P10 or lower 3 days
P11 to P50 15 days
P51 to P100 30 Days
P101 to P150 45 Days
P151- P250 60 days
P251 – P300 75 days
above P300 120 days

However, the memorandum states that for each new load that is purchased, the amount of the unused loads earlier purchased that are still within the validity period shall be added to and accumulate to the new load. The new minimum validity or expiry period shall be based on the sum of the new load plus the unused load.
